A 1945 Ex. Admiralty Harbour Service Launch built by McGruers of Dumbarton and professionally converted to a comfortable motor-yacht.
Overall Length: 55' (16.6m) :: Waterline: 51' (15.45m) :: Beam: 12' 3" (3.72m) :: Draught: 5' 3" (1.60m) :: Displacement: 23 Tons
Designer: Admiralty :: Builder: McGruers of Dumbarton :: Location: Central London
Sail: None :: Berths: 4 :: Price: £58,500

Double diagonal teak hull, copper sheathed below the waterline, steel plate decks, marine-ply and West Epoxy sheathed. Marine-ply superstructure. Recently re-appointed accommodation with forward saloon, master cabin with double berth, heads and shower compartment. Spacious deck saloon / wheelhouse. Aft cabin with well equipped galley, covered aft deck. Dedicated engine room. Recent out of water survey by specialist boatyard with recommendations carried out. New cutlass bearing and antifouling.
